Investors in Peabody Energy should be aware that the deadline for filing a class action lawsuit is approaching. This legal action stems from allegations that the company misled shareholders regarding its financial health and future prospects. As one of the largest coal producers in the world, Peabody has faced significant challenges, including fluctuating coal prices and environmental regulations. These factors have raised concerns about the company’s sustainability and profitability, ultimately impacting stock prices.
The class action aims to hold Peabody accountable for any harm caused to investors who purchased shares during the period of alleged misinformation. Affected investors are encouraged to join the lawsuit to potentially recover losses incurred due to a decline in stock value.
